looks like that cve-search configuration in the configuration.ini file is ignored.
roy@ubuntu:/Desktop/CVE-Scan-master/bin$ python3 Nmap2CVE-Search.py -xN test2.xml/Desktop/CVE-Scan-master/bin$ more ../etc/configuration.ini
Could not connect to the CVE-Search API on localhost:5000
roy@ubuntu:
[Webserver]
Host: 127.0.0.1
Port: 5050
Debug: True
[CVE-Search]
cve-searchHost: cve.circl.lu
cve-searchPort: 80
I've changed the default host in the Config.py file but I get "Could not connect to the CVE-Search API on cve.circl.lu:80"
The API is accessible from the same machine using CURL.

thanks for providing this software and I really like its functionality. I realized that by default the scan report can be found on a web server on port 5050. This is suitable if the report consumer is a person. However, we want to utilize some policies to automate the patch management. Therefore we need a machine-readable report (e.g. xml formated). I could not find such info through README. Could someone please let me know what is the most convenient way to generate such report? if there is no such function yet, could someone let me know which class in the code gathered all report data before present them into web? In that case I can try to see if we can convert the report format there.
